I don’t be know if this has been posted.

Grant Williams had a game this past season where he went 23-23 from the line. He had another game where he was 14-14 from the line.

He averaged 7 FTs per game.

Also, both Carsen Edwards and Romeo Langford averages 6 FTs per game. For a team that was poor at getting to the line, Boston drafted 3 guys that get to the line at a high frequency.
